So, I have discovered a great product that I don't mind how much she uses to smear on her lips, hands, cheeks, and wherever else it seems end up: For My Kids All-Natural Vegan Lip Balm.
This great product comes in a cute little metal tin. The ingredient list is something you could definitely whip up at home (in your free time all you Moms - haha). Organic sweet almond oil, organic coconut oil, organic cocoa butter, candelilla wax, organic tamanu oil and organic peppermint essential oil. As you can see, from that ingredient list, there is nothing worrisome if your little tot gets a little overzealous with their "lipstick" application.
The balm has a soft, smooth consistency, and stays on very well. It also has a nice,mild peppermint smell and flavour. It is available in vanilla flavor as well. It also isn't "sweetened" like some lip concoctions meant for children, which, to me, just seems to encourage them to eat them.
I have used this balm on my 6 months old teething rash that is all over his cheeks, his chin, his other chin and his other chin (chunky monkey, what can I say), as well as all those darling little neck rolls. I don't worry if it gets into his mouth as he is so busy, chewing away on his toys, his sister, the dog (although if you have nut allergies in the family I would be very cautious due to the nut oils in the balm).
